About this ebook

It was to be her greatest masquerade . . .

Pamela Darby needs a man—preferably a Highland brute with more brawn than brains. Determined to save her sister from selling her virtue, the resourceful beauty requires a strapping specimen to pose as a duke's long-lost heir. Pamela plans to collect the generous reward, then send him on his way. Lucky for the brazen beauty, the seductive, silver-eyed highwayman who just held up their carriage could be her man . . .

Connor Kincaid has given up on his dream of restoring his clan's honor. And now this plucky Englishwoman is asking him to take part in a risky charade that could land them both on the gallows. Never a man to resist a challenge or the allure of a beautiful woman, Connor strikes the devil's bargain that could seal both their fates. The highwayman and the hellion journey to London as both enemies and allies—a woman who has everything to gain and a man who has nothing to lose . . . but his heart.

Teresa Medeiros

New York Times bestselling author Teresa Medeiros wrote her first novel at the age of twenty-one and has since gone on to win the hearts of both readers and critics. A two-time recipient of the Waldenbooks Award for bestselling fiction, Teresa makes her home in Kentucky with her husband and two cats.

    First of all, great humor, which I missed a bit in the first part of this series. The plot is not that unique and the end is predictable, but the execution is wonderful. I love the characters.
    Nice detail: part 1 is partly a road story where the sister travels north, part 2 is partly a road story where the brother travels south.

    I have quickly become a fan of Ms. M. This wasn't my favorite, but I still enjoyed it. There were several eye Rolling moments that stretched my edges of belief, but in the end, that added to the melodramatic nature of this story. Pamela was well characterized as the responsible older sibling who craved the adventure that would only validate her dishonorable birth, and readers could anticipate the truth about Connor, the highwayman, fairly quickly. Like a scene out of Cat Ballou, I loved the rescue from hanging. Sophie might have been better characterized, but as a secondary character, it wasn't as important. I would recommend this as a light romp, more appealing to those who appreciate the word "mellerdrama".

    I was expecting a typical historical romance plot. However, this book was different. It has all the same elements, but very well done. Connor is a highwayman who meets Pamela with a gun in his hand. Of course, Pamela proves this as no obstacle, and begins their journey. Agreeing to help each other out with the masquerade, they begin to see eye to eye.I didn't give it 4 stars because it was a slow start for me. However, I thoroughly enjoyed from the middle to the end of the book. What a great love story between Connor and Pamela. Of course, there were other “love stories” among other characters that just added to the depth of the book. Once this momentum hit, it continued all the way to the end of the book. Lots of great characters who you grew to love. Crispin, in the beginning I kind of hated, but in the end he changed my mind. Great character development.The romance scenes are hot and fairly detailed. Verdict: This cover is absolutely beautiful. I was looking for a Teresa Medeiros book, not having read anything by her before, and of course it was the cover that encouraged me to pick it up and read the summary. I will definitely read another book by this same author.Recommendation: To anyone who loves historical romances.
